A plant for the production of domestic boards for electronics will be launched in Rostov-on-Don in the spring of 2024.
GC "Beshtau" plans to start with small capacities: 1.4 thousand square dm per day or about 35 thousand square dm per month.
At first, these will be fourth-class accuracy boards for simple devices and tools.
In the next two years, Rostov will master the production of fifth and sixth accuracy class boards at this enterprise. They are installed on gadgets, laptops, household appliances, and some medical equipment. For this, the plant will need to install high-precision premium equipment.
Of the total volume, the plant plans to sell 40% of its board products to domestic electronics manufacturers. The rest will be kept for itself: next year the company launches the production of laptops from completely domestic components in Rostov.
Manufacturers are looking forward to it: domestic boards in Russia are in short supply. Russian board manufacturers cover only 10% of the market demand for them.
Currently, Russian electronics manufacturers purchase 90% of boards in China and other countries that have not joined the anti-Russian sanctions. But it is more difficult for companies with a large number of foreign parts in their devices to enter the public procurement market or receive preferences from the state.
